Maintaining a breeding colony of 20 oniscoid isopods ("roly- polies" or pillbugs) in a jar and studying allele frequencies of a gene that controls the number of bristles on the legs. The genotype AA has 12 bristles, Aa has 6 bristles, and aa has no bristles. Assuming that in generation 1, p(A) = .6 and that there are no mutations and no natural selection occurring: What is the most likely outcome after many generations?
